最新文章列表

AES加密和解密

本文重点在于如何在JAVA和Python中使用AES,以及相关的重要概念,而不是专门讲AES算法原理。   AES作为一个块加密算法 [block cipher],每次加密的明文大小固定为128bit,所以明文比较长的时候需要先分组再加密然后整合,这个过程中就会出现两个重要的因素:模式 和 填充方式。     1. 模式 分组密码工作模式,常用的包含ECB,CBC,OFB,CFB和C ...
xuanzhui 评论(0) 有4387人浏览 2017-11-15 20:10

DES加密

DES 对称加密方式,在通信过程中经常用到。DES有四种加密模式:   1. ECB Electronic Codebook 最古老简单的模式,加密数据长度必须为8的倍数(不足8位添加padding),密钥必须为8位。不依赖向量,易受到字典攻击。不推荐。 2. CBC Cipher Block Chaining 引入初始化vector,可以使用不同的Vector产生不同的密文。缺点 ...
tcspecial 评论(0) 有2694人浏览 2017-01-25 10:13

对称算法的四种运行模式

对称算法使用一个密钥。给定一个明文和一个密钥,加密产生密文,其长度和明文大致相同。解密时,使用的密钥与加密密钥相同。 对称算法主要有四种加密模式: 一 电子密码本模式 Electronic Code Book(ECB) 这种模式是最早采用和最简单的模式,它将加密的数据分成若干组,每组的大小跟加密密钥长度相同,然后每组都用相同的密钥进行加密。 其缺点是:电子密码本模式用一个密钥加密消息的所 ...
cakin24 评论(0) 有1189人浏览 2016-12-08 20:40

为golang 增加aes ecb模式

http://studygolang.com/articles/6114
lyp2002924 评论(0) 有2001人浏览 2016-02-22 10:25

让Emacs ECB支持鼠标

ECB模式开启四个窗口,可以浏览目录,源码文件,方法和历史记录,但是默认只支持键盘操作,RET才能打开。 要支持鼠标需如下操作: 1.在 Emacs 中执行“ M-x ecb-customize-most-important ”,找到“ Ecb Primary Secondary Mouse Buttons ”选项 2.将其设为“ Primary: mouse-1 ...
cn.popeye 评论(0) 有2741人浏览 2011-09-02 10:24

最近博客热门TAG

Java(141747) C(73651) C++(68608) SQL(64571) C#(59609) XML(59133) HTML(59043) JavaScript(54918) .net(54785) Web(54513) 工作(54116) Linux(50906) Oracle(49876) 应用服务器(43288) Spring(40812) 编程(39454) Windows(39381) JSP(37542) MySQL(37268) 数据结构(36423)

博客人气排行榜

    博客电子书下载排行

      >>浏览更多下载

      相关资讯

      相关讨论

      Global site tag (gtag.js) - Google Analytics